JavaScript 中的 new 关键字是什么?
在本文中,我们将准确了解什么是 new 关键字,为什么使用 new 关键字,以及如何使用 new 关键字。
JavaScript 中的 new 关键字: new 关键字用于创建用户定义的对象类型和构造函数的实例。它用于构造并返回构造函数的对象。
句法:
new constructor[([arguments])]
为什么我们在 JavaScript 中使用 new 关键字?
这些是使用新关键字的以下功能:
- new 关键字创建一个具有对象类型的新空对象。
- new 关键字设置构造函数的内部原型属性。
- new 关键字将此变量绑定到新创建的对象。
- new 关键字返回新对象。
示例 1:在下面的示例中,我们将创建一个消息函数来打印带有问候的姓名,我们将创建一个消息函数的实例。
Javascript
Javascript
输出:控制台输出
Hey Vikash
示例 2:在下面的示例中,我们将创建一个学生函数并使用 new 关键字创建该函数的一个实例,如下所示。
Javascript
输出: